Brief Summary
The goal of this randomized controlled trial was to learn whether a combined aerobic and resistance exercise program could improve physical function and muscle health in people receiving peritoneal dialysis. Researchers compared an exercise group with a control group to evaluate the effects of regular exercise. The main questions the study aimed to answer were:
- Can regular exercise improve physical performance and muscle strength in people receiving peritoneal dialysis?
- Can regular exercise improve body composition and blood markers related to muscle health? Before the exercise program, participants completed a one-month training period to learn the exercises and practice them safely. Participants in the exercise group:
- Performed combined aerobic and resistance exercises for 8 weeks
- Completed assessments before and after the exercise program Participants in the control group:
- Continued their usual care
- Completed assessments before and after the study period

Outcome Measures
Primary Outcomes (4)
Physical Performance
Changes in physical performance assessed using the 6-minute walk test after 8 weeks of combined aerobic and resistance exercise.
Baseline and after 8 weeks of intervention
Changes in right handgrip strength
Changes in right handgrip strength measured in kilograms after 8 weeks of combined aerobic and resistance exercise.
Baseline and after 8 weeks of intervention
Changes in left handgrip strength
Changes in left handgrip strength measured in kilograms after 8 weeks of combined aerobic and resistance exercise.
Baseline and after 8 weeks of intervention
Changes in leg strength
Changes in lower extremity muscle strength measured using a leg and back dynamometer after 8 weeks of combined aerobic and resistance exercise.
Baseline and after 8 weeks of intervention

Eligibility Criteria
You may qualify if:
- Adults aged 18 years or older
- Receiving peritoneal dialysis for at least 6 months
- Ability to sit and stand independently
You may not qualify if:
- Myocardial infarction within the previous 6 months
- History of cardiac surgery
- Uncontrolled hypertension
- Pericardial or pleural effusion
- Aortic stenosis
- Active lower extremity amputation, prosthesis, or fracture
- History of osteoporotic fractures
- Regular participation in sports or structured exercise
- Advanced cognitive impairment
